Founded in 1976, the KAAMA Racing Team is widely regarded as one of the most successful offshore powerboat racing teams in history. Having started in well over 70 races, KAAMA earned its respect not only on the racecourse, but also through its forward-thinking engineering solutions, which undoubtedly helped advance the performance boat industry.
The KAAMA Racing Team consisted of Betty Cook as driver, John Connor as crew chief & throttleman, various navigators, as well as engineering partner Peter Weismann.
Betty Cook was 52 years old and a grandmother, stood 5' 4" tall and weighed barely 114 pounds. Within three years she would be World Champion in Key West. She won 17 races in all including 2 world championships and 3 national championships. The open ocean didn't care if you were a grandmother or a young rookie - everyone competed against the same odds.
The 38-foot Scarab is by far one of the most recognized hull designs in the world and respected because of its light weight and high speeds. Initially engineered by John Connor as a replacement for the Cigarette hull, the first Scarab hull was built by Larry Smith for KAAMA Racing.
Now 40 years later and after a full restoration by Thomas Jewsbury, who previously restored the Miami Vice boat, KAAMA is back and better than ever!
Everything on KAAMA was restored to its original form, which required Jason Saris and his team at Performance Marine to build some parts that are no longer produced. KAAMA's hull is made out of kevlar, the same material used in bulletproof vests and a stronger fiberglass deck was fabricated to replace the old flimsy kevlar one. Two people can operate the boat, three is optimal. Someone to drive, someone to throttle and someone to navigate. She is powered by two 572 cid fuel injected engines (750 HP each), number three speedmaster drives and only has 20 hrs of run time. The 1979 Scarab Larry Smith 38 is a classic performance powerboat known for its sleek design and powerful capabilities. Here are some pros and cons to consider:
Pros
Iconic Design: The Scarab Larry Smith 38 features a timeless, sporty look that stands out on the water.
Performance: Equipped with robust engines, this boat delivers impressive speed and agility, making it ideal for enthusiasts who enjoy high-performance boating.
Build Quality: Known for solid construction and durable materials, it offers reliability and longevity when properly maintained.
Spacious Layout: Despite its performance focus, the 38 model provides comfortable seating and ample space for passengers.
Cons
Maintenance: Being a vintage boat from 1979, it may require more frequent upkeep and parts replacement compared to modern boats.
Fuel Efficiency: High-performance engines typically consume more fuel, which can increase operating costs.
Technology: Lacks the modern electronics and conveniences found in newer models, such as advanced navigation systems or integrated entertainment.
Availability of Parts: Finding specific replacement parts for a 1979 model might be challenging and potentially costly.
